Don't send mail. I had the same problem. After hours of rebuilding my PC etc I found that this was down to a seeting for your display. I had set the appearance to Large Icons and when you reboot your machine this affects the DVD/ CD Drive icons. To change this ICON setting you go to the desktop. Right click and go to properties, appearance TAB, Effects button and chnage the tick in the Large Icons settings. You must reboot your computer for the changes to be effective.
